Roasted Halibut with Walnut Crust Recipe

Roasted Halibut with Walnut Crust has a high-calorie, low-carb, high-fat and very high-protein content.

The food contains 4g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 49 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its high fat content, it could be unsuit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ons.

It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.

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.

Nutrition Facts

Serving size

Amount Per Serving

Calories 410 Calories from Fat 190

% Daily Value *

Total Fat 21 g 32.3%

Saturated Fat 8 g 40%

Trans Fat

Cholesterol 105 mg 35%

Sodium 210 mg 8.8%

Total Carbohydrates 4 g 1.3%

Dietary Fiber 1 g4%

Sugars 0 g

Protein 49 g 98%

Vitamin A 20% Vitamin C 10%

Calcium 10% Iron 15%

*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
